Output e28c589518e8921a18df2af5c37ee1caa3ee74e8e4a9e9ae735330f4f89743ae: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88d828c6fae1974f7abf6ebd656379fd62530ed8 OP_EQUAL
address
3EAameFy2ZEiQmHZLD2XMVkc1ujFQ2bRLo
transaction
e28c589518e8921a18df2af5c37ee1caa3ee74e8e4a9e9ae735330f4f89743ae
confirmations
482447
spent
true